 * Is there any way to filter date currently? My client wants a list of every month
   in each year going back on the search in a dropdown, but currently the only option
   I can see to achieve this with this plugin is to create a mirrored taxonomy and
   use that.
 * Or have I missed something obvious? 🙂

 * You could create a custom field, that you index and add to your facets.
